Output 7cf3c5ac8c620d0b545f3e843ecac8224f1f6d00401a51e1f766cac754558f86:6

value
3069878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a6cdfb3c998519e291c6bddaf7ab107683858e OP_EQUAL
address
3NSj8spkLyzkFBJFDE51cHSc3u4u5rPDJw
transaction
7cf3c5ac8c620d0b545f3e843ecac8224f1f6d00401a51e1f766cac754558f86
spent
true